Reliance Producers Cooperative Becomes a Pioneering FDA-Approved Manufacturer

Carmona, Philippines – In a significant stride towards supporting the country’s healthcare system amidst the ongoing battle with COVID-19, Reliance Producers Cooperative (RPC) has been granted FDA approval to manufacture medical-grade protective wear for health workers and frontliners. As the Philippines faces a surge in COVID-19 cases, the government reached out to RPC to repurpose its operations to address the growing shortage of certified, locally manufactured personal protective equipment (PPE). In response to this urgent call, RPC’s Carmona facility has successfully obtained a License to Operate (LTO) as a Medical Device Manufacturer from the Philippine Food and Drug Administration (FDA). Pioneering a New Standard of Safety RPC Carmona is proud to become the first garments manufacturer in the Philippines to receive FDA approval, paving the way for the production of high-quality medical-grade protective wear. This new certification allows the cooperative to manufacture items such as medical face masks, face shields, and other essential protective equipment that meet stringent standards for use by healthcare professionals.
